The Analysis of Geological Characteristics and Metallogenic Potential of Xilaokou Gold Deposit

Abstract
Xilaokou gold deposit is located in the northern edge of Jiao-Lai basin,the western of Muping-Rushan gold ore belt.The main strata are Paleoproterozoic Jingshan group and Mesozoic Laiyang group.The main magma activity is Yanshan Period,the structure which has a close relationship with gold mineralization is complex.At present,gold resource reserve(333)+(334) has reached to medium size in Xilaokou gold mining,the type of mineralization is altered rock type.This paper analyzes the characteristics of geophysical,geochemical,ore vein and orebody of ore deposit,it summarized up the regularity of metallogenic and criteria for ore prospecting.According to contrast with typical gold deposit,we speculate that this area has the condition of forming large mine.
